The Receivables Turnover ratio meas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ance. It is calculated as Revenue divided by average Accounts Receivable. An efficient company has a higher accounts receivable turnover ratio while an inefficient company has a lower ratio. Questor Technology's Revenue for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$0.36 Mil. Questor Technology's average Accounts Receivable for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$0.75 Mil. Hence, Questor Technology's Receivables Turnover for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 0.49.

Questor Technology Receivables Turnover Calculation

Receivables Turnover meas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ance.

Questor Technology's Receivables Turnover for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(A: Dec. 2025 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(A: Dec. 2025 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2024 ) +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2025 )) / count )
=4.926 / ((0.949 + 0.625) / 2 )
=4.926 / 0.787
=6.26

Questor Technology's Receivables Turnover for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(Q: Mar. 2026 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(Q: Dec. 2025 ) + Accounts Receivable (Q: Mar. 2026 )) / count )
=0.364 / ((0.625 + 0.87) / 2 )
=0.364 / 0.7475
=0.49

Questor Technology Business Description

Other Exchanges QST:Canada
Address 707 - 8th Avenue SW, Suite 1920, Calgary, AB, CAN, T2P 1H5
Questor Technology Inc is focused on clean air technologies that safely and cost-effectively improve air quality, support energy efficiency, and greenhouse gas emissions reductions. The company designs, manufactures, and services high-efficiency waste gas combustion systems. Its combustion technology is utilized in the effective management of Methane, Hydrogen Sulfide gas, Volatile Organic Hydrocarbons, Hazardous Air Pollutants, and BTEX gases, ensuring sustainable development, community acceptance, and regulatory compliance. It has developed heat-to-power generation technology and is marketing its solutions to various markets, including landfill biogas, syngas, waste engine exhaust, geothermal, and solar, cement plant waste heat, in addition to a wide variety of oil and gas projects.
